Handover — Vexler partner SFTP drop

Ownership moves to you today. Drop runs hourly from Vexler's end into the intake bucket via the relay host. Watch for zero-byte files; their exporter flakes on Mondays. Creds live in the ops vault, path noted in the runbook. Vault auto-seals after 48h idle. Support escalations go to the on-call rotation, not me. If the vault is sealed when you need it, unseal with the recovery passphrase below.

recovery phrase for tadug-fafof: zorwyn-kasion

### Meeting notes — Spares for Redgate Relay Station (excerpt)

Attendees agreed the spare pump seals, two control boards, and the backup sensor kit ship this Friday via Ferrow Logistics. Redgate is remote; next run after this is in six weeks, so receiving should inspect and confirm counts same day. Damaged items go back on the return leg. Packing list rides inside crate 1. When the courier arrives at the gate, follow the confidential hand-over instruction appended immediately below.

drop instructions, yafog-yawip: the quenmir olidor courier leaves the julox tamion keliel ledger at gate 5283 under passcode 336825

Every successful donation through the Givewell-of-Harrow portal triggers a job that renders a PDF receipt and hands it to our internal mailer, Postfern. When reviewing changes here, please verify that retries are idempotent — duplicate receipts are our most common donor complaint. The mailer client is constructed in receipts/mailer.py and expects a Postfern endpoint plus credentials at startup. For local review builds, point at the Postfern sandbox and authenticate with the internal key provided below.

service key, yadug-bajog: zpat3_pou

### Deep-Link Routing (quick orientation)

Welcome aboard! When a Fernpath deep link lands, the router checks the scheme, then the tenant slug, then falls back to the web view. Most bugs are stale route tables — flush them with `fernctl routes sync` before blaming the app. If a link still dead-ends, grab the trace token printed at startup, shown below.

build token for kahop-kagag: htk31_38a3512afc721db8009f808ec553b14